Navigating Land Acquisition and Site Development
Finding the right spot for your custom home in Suwanee is a big step, and it’s one where having an experienced builder by your side can make a huge difference. They can help you look at potential lots with a critical eye, spotting things you might miss. For instance, they can assess how easy it will be to get construction vehicles and materials to the site, or identify any potential challenges with the land itself that could add unexpected costs or delays. They can also advise on the best way to orient your house on the lot to take advantage of natural light and energy efficiency. If you’re looking to build near Lake Lanier, builders with specific knowledge of U.S. Army Corps of Engineers regulations are invaluable for a smooth process. Getting this right from the start sets a strong foundation for the entire project.

Building on Lake Lanier with Corps of Engineers Expertise
If you’re dreaming of a home on Lake Lanier, there’s a specific set of rules to follow. Building near the lake means dealing with the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ers regulations. It’s a bit of a process, but having a builder who knows these rules inside and out makes a huge difference. They can handle the permits and make sure everything is built correctly, so you don’t have to worry about it. This kind of specialized knowledge is key for a smooth build on the water.

Understanding Fixed-Price Contracts
When you’re building a custom home, the contract you sign with your builder is a big deal. A fixed-price contract, for example, means the total cost of the project is agreed upon upfront. This can offer a lot of certainty for your budget. However, it’s important to understand what’s included and how changes are handled. If you decide to add something or change a material, there will likely be an additional cost, often called a change order. It’s wise to have a bit of extra money set aside, maybe 10-20% of the total cost, just in case unexpected things pop up or you decide to make some adjustments during the build. This buffer can save you from a lot of stress later on.
A fixed-price contract provides cost predictability, but clear communication about any deviations is key to avoiding surprises. Always clarify the process for change orders and their potential impact on the overall budget and timeline.
